Reimagining Spaces: The Human-Centered SMART Building
Smart buildings are evolving. They're moving towards a human-centric experience. This transformation prioritizes the occupant, catering to their well-being and productivity.
A truly human-centered SMART building harmoniously blends cutting-edge technology with thoughtful design approaches. It adapts to user behavior, optimizing conditions for individual comfort and success.
This means deploying technologies that adjust lighting based on natural light, maintaining ideal warmth, and even curating audio experiences.
Ultimately, these technologies aim to foster a sense of well-being, allowing occupants to focus.
Sustainability: Core Principles of SMART Design
SMART design fundamentally revolves around the core principles of sustainability and efficiency. These aren't just buzzwords; they represent a fundamental shift in how we approach product development and service implementation. By adopting sustainable practices, designers can minimize their impact on the planet while maximizing resource deployment. Efficiency, on the other hand, is about enhancing processes to reduce waste and enhance performance. When combined, these principles create a framework for truly innovative and impactful design that benefits both people and the planet.
- Consider the entire lifecycle of a product or service, from raw material sourcing to end-of-life management.
- Prioritize renewable and recyclable materials whenever possible.
- Decrease energy consumption throughout the design and production process.
